United Kingdom Trademark Search > Bazuru Ltd. (1 records)

Page 1 of 1

1
Goods and Services: Graphic drawings;Graphic prints and representations;Printed advertisements.|Website tra...
BAZURU LTD.
LIVE (Circa: 2021)

BAZURU